The Bank of Thailand Scholarship Announcement
The Bank of Thailand is pleased to announce The BOT scholarship. This announcement is provided for outstanding Thai-citizen students who receive an offer to study in 2008 or are currently studying for a PhD in the areas of Econometrics or Macroeconomic Modeling, or studying Economics and writing a dissertation on a topic pertaining Econometrics or Macroeconomic Modeling in the academic institutions listed in the BOT’s list of prescriptive universities. more...

Welcome to Samaggi Samagom
Samaggi, a beautiful Thai word that could be translated as cohesion, unity and togetherness, hence, “Samaggi Samagom.” Established by H.M. King Rama VI (Vajiravudh), in the year 1901 during his educational years in the United Kingdom.
King Vajiravudh’s was educated in the United Kingdom in 1893 to 1901 at Christ Church College of Oxford University. Thereafter his graduation, ‘Samaggi Samagom’ was established with an aim to reinforce harmonious relationships of the growing number of Thai students in the United Kingdom by providing activities including sports, debating and musical events.
When King Vajiravudh returned to Thailand to succeed the throne, he entered ‘Samaggi Samagom’ into the Royal Patronage, and assigned the elegant and prestigious symbol as is known today. Moreover, Samaggi Samagom is arguably the most deep-rooted and prestigious committee for Thais; as there are no other committee established by the King.
Today, after 107 years of commemoration, Samaggi Samagom still operates as a student-run committee. It remains a representation of an ‘umbrella’ for all Thai Societies in the United Kingdom to make university life more enjoyable and eventful. The Royal Thai Embassy and the Anglo-Thai Society are a few of many stakeholders to help enforce the Committees’ objective founded by King Vajiravudh.
Furthermore, Samaggi Samagom is proud to have had the opportunity to nurture alumni that have played a significant role in Thai politics, economics and society. These role model includes Khun Anan Panyarachun, Rear Admiral ML Usni Pramoj, Prof. Dr. Chirayu Isarangkun Na Ayuthaya, Prof. Yongyuth Yuthavong, Khun Abhisit Vejjajiva and many more.
